Small-Signal Amplifier
GENERAL DESCRIPTION
The KGF1146 is a two-stage small-signal UHF-band amplifier that features low current operation, high output power, and high isolation. The KGF1146 specifications are guaranteed to a fixed matching circuit for 5 V and 850 MHz; external impedance-matching circuits are also required. Because of the high isolation, the KGF1146 is an ideal part for a VCO-buffer amplifiers and an intermediate-stage amplifier for personal handy phones, such as cellular phones.
FEATURES
* Low current operation: 2.5 mA (max.) * High output power: 1.5 dBm (min.) * High isolation: -40 dB * Self-bias circuit configuration with built-in source capacitor * Package: 4PSOP
